Overview

The MRC La Haute-Côte-Nord's Support for Preliminary Studies and Expertise Funds for Project Implementation (PSEFE) provides non-repayable financial assistance up to $40,000 to eligible organizations for feasibility and pre-feasibility studies. The program aims to advance business projects and resolve development impasses through external expertise.

MRC La Haute-Côte-Nord — Support for preliminary studies and expertise funds for project implementation (PSEFE) - Legacy manual context

Eligibility

Who is eligible?

  • Private companies, excluding those in the financial sector
  • Social economy enterprises
  • Non-profit organizations
  • Municipal organizations

Who is not eligible

  • Private companies within the financial sector.
  • Any promoter in default of payment obligations to the MRC.
  • Projects supporting relocation of an enterprise or part of its production outside its local municipality.
  • Projects in the retail trade or restaurant sector, except for local service offerings.

Eligible expenses

  • Salaries and professional fees related to the development of project plans and studies.
  • Assessment of project viability, including market analysis.
  • Evaluation of the technical and financial feasibility of a project.
  • Definition and refinement of a concept.
  • Professional fees for legal assistance in business acquisition.
  • Development and refinement of tools or indicators for sectoral measurement, including traffic and economic impact studies related to projects.

Eligible geographic areas

  • MRC La Haute-Côte-Nord.

Selection criteria

  • The project aligns with regional priorities and strategic orientations identified in the strategic planning of the MRC La Haute-Côte-Nord.
  • The innovative nature of the project, which includes managerial innovation, new processes, new technologies, new value-added products, new markets, and territorial development prospects.
  • The potential for successful completion of the final project.
  • The overall quality of the application file.
  • The experience and involvement of the promoter(s) and partners engaged in the project.
  • The financial situation of the promoter(s).

How to apply

  • Step 1: Prepare Application MaterialsDescribe the project in detail, highlighting the need for a preliminary study and providing an implementation timeline.
  • Assess the project's impact on the economic diversification of La Haute-Côte-Nord.
  • Detail the project's cost and financing structure.
  • Include copies of any submitted or approved funding applications.
  • Provide a cost estimate, or in the case of a municipality, an evaluation of the costs.
  • Attach the latest financial statements if the promoter is active.
  • Present the promoter's history, organizational structure, and a brief description of current activities if applicable.
  • Step 2: Compile Necessary DocumentationEnsure all necessary documents are collected and organized for submission.
  • Verify that all application requirements are met with complete documentation.
  • Step 3: Submit ApplicationSubmit the prepared application along with the necessary documentation to the MRC La Haute-Côte-Nord's appropriate office or platform as specified in their application guidelines.

Additional information

  • The contribution is non-repayable and subject to repayment only if the project is carried out outside the MRC La Haute-Côte-Nord within five years following receipt of financial support.
  • Immobilized resources include directorate general and the economic development service.
  • A personal loan counts toward the promoter's contribution if it is not reimbursed by company funds.
  • All investors, including private capital and venture capital firms, must have a full exit plan post-repayment of any local funds' loans to be counted toward promoter contributions.
